Transaction 1f66f9ad847f7e24dac774157389ef954d7cbb15d7e0796e63c9667016cc41ca

2 Input
2 Outputs
  • 1f66f9ad847f7e24dac774157389ef954d7cbb15d7e0796e63c9667016cc41ca:0
  • value  2448071
    address  13EJwtMt1j1ded7qDbWpKRQM7PGoV6RV5C
  • 1f66f9ad847f7e24dac774157389ef954d7cbb15d7e0796e63c9667016cc41ca:1
  • value  1068266
    address  1Ajsg7QHmrsMZRTGbNppsuPA9r4i9bqCex